Overview

This thrilling 5-day Migration Adventure takes you from the iconic ancient baobab trees of Tarangire to the dramatic crossings of the Mara River in the Northern Serengeti. Along the way, witness breathtaking landscapes, incredible wildlife encounters, and a season permitting the awe-inspiring Great Migration as wildebeest and zebra brave crocodile-infested waters. This tour is unique as it provides you with a chance to experience one of nature’s greatest events up close. Activity itinerary

Day 1: Arusha to Tarangire National Park.

Your safari adventure begins with a scenic drive from Arusha, descending into the baobab-studded landscape of Tarangire National Park. This park is famous for its massive elephant herds and ancient, towering trees. As you enter the gate, the wildlife viewing begins immediately. Spend the day exploring the Tarangire River ecosystem, a vital water source that attracts thousands of animals during the dry season. Look for lions lounging in the branches of trees, impressive buffalo herds, and the elusive leopard. After a full day of game drives, you'll ascend into the highlands to the charming coffee plantation area of Karatu. You will check into the beautiful Tloma Lodge, known for its stunning views and tranquil atmosphere. Enjoy a delicious dinner and a restful night, listening to the sounds of the countryside, ready for your journey to the Serengeti tomorrow.

After an early breakfast, you'll journey onwards, passing through the Ngorongoro Conservation Area with breathtaking views from the crater's rim. You'll then enter the vast, endless plains of the Serengeti National Park. The drive north is an adventure in itself, with game viewing all the way as you transition from the central plains to the rugged, river-cut landscapes of the north. Your destination is the Kogatende area, the hub of the Mara River crossings. You will arrive at your authentic and comfortable mobile camp, Mara Kati Kati Tented Camp, perfectly situated to maximize your time with the migration. After lunch, embark on your first afternoon game drive in the region. Immediately, you'll feel the tension in the air—vast herds of wildebeest and zebra gather on the banks, and the air is filled with their constant grunts. Return to camp for a sundowner and a hearty dinner under the spectacular African night sky.

Today is dedicated entirely to the main event. After a quick coffee and snack, you'll head out at dawn when the light is soft and wildlife is active. Your expert guide will communicate with other drivers to locate herds on the move. You'll spend the day patrolling the banks of the Mara River, waiting for that iconic moment. The anticipation is electric as thousands of animals gather, hesitate, and finally take the perilous plunge into the crocodile-infested waters. Witness the chaos, courage, and raw survival instinct of the crossing—a true natural spectacle unlike any other. The action doesn't stop at the river; keep an eye out for predators like lions and hyenas waiting to ambush exhausted animals that make it across. Enjoy a packed lunch at a scenic spot right in the heart of the action. Return to camp in the evening, exhilarated and filled with incredible memories.

Enjoy one last morning game drive in the Northern Serengeti, searching for any action you might have missed. After a leisurely brunch at camp, begin your journey south towards the Central Serengeti (Seronera). This drive offers a chance to see the changing landscape of the park and more fantastic game viewing en route. The Central Serengeti is renowned for its year-round wildlife concentrations and dramatic granite kopjes. You'll arrive at Into Wild Africa Tented Camp, your intimate base for exploring this rich region. An afternoon game drive in the Seronera River Valley might reveal leopards resting in sausage trees, cheetahs scanning the plains for prey, and large prides of lions. Enjoy the vibrant energy of the central plains before returning to your camp for a final night in the wild.

After an early breakfast, you bid farewell to the Serengeti and drive towards the Ngorongoro Conservation Area. Your final destination is the Ngorongoro Crater,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and the world's largest intact volcanic caldera. You'll descend the steep walls into this 260 km² Eden, which is home to an astonishing density of wildlife, including the rare black rhino. Enjoy a spectacular final game drive on the crater floor, often called "Africa's Garden of Eden." The crater offers a high chance of seeing the Big Five in a single, breathtaking setting. After your exploration, you will ascend the crater rim and begin your journey back to Arusha, where you will be dropped off at your hotel or the airport for your departure, filled with a lifetime of memories.
